Support the company through protocol and reports management. Perform complex data and operational analysis focused on achieving business goals and objectives in support of and working directly with the finance team. Utilizes data analysis, work plans and audit tools to appropriately analyze and trend information to support operational and procedural decisions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Be a role model in projecting and applying The Pacific Group Diamond Philosophy (Productivity, Quality, Excellence and teamwork) and promote teamwork at all times.
  • Responsible for working with leadership team on review and maintenance of processes and procedures in operational department.
  • Contribute to the day-to-day accounting and finance function; confirm that proper daily financial transactions are recorded in the general ledger on a timely/accurate basis (A/R, A/P, Inventory)
  • Measures and evaluates the effectiveness of protocols, programs or deliverables.
  • Administer all aspects of data reporting.
  • Produce data reports for the sales team to utilize in customer business review meetings.
  • Work with Business Solutions Group to improve and streamline client reporting.
  • Perform cost-benefit and return on investment analyses for proposed changes to aide management in making decisions.
  • Identify areas of improvement as related to efficiency and productivity of data gathering and reporting management.
  • Identify resolutions to problems, communicate action steps with all parties involved, and maintain corrected data for future queries
  • Supports team develop and improve processing of contract modifications.
  • Develop recommendations and solutions resulting from data.
  • Work with team members and supervisors to make decisions to profitably and aggressively grow the business.
  • Perform other duties, as assigned.

What You Bring to Pacific Seafood:

Required

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in a related field.

Preferred

  • Minimum one year experience in detailed business analysis reporting.
  • Experience with Microsoft applications, and proficient in Excel and Word.
  • Background in accounting.
